Anyways, back to your topic. Mena never approved of Mahadev just because of the way he looked and appeared in public since all the other gods looked way better in public in comparison to him. But like the other person said, when he showed his true form, Mena was very eager to see her daughter married off to him. The way Mahadev is described in texts, a normal mother would not want him to be in a 100 mile radius of her daughter but we all know how it all ended. 😊
